PHPackages                             techrino/vue-tailwind-laravel-ui-preset - PHPackages - PHPackages  [Skip to content](#main-content)[PHPackages](/)[Directory](/)[Categories](/categories)[Trending](/trending)[Leaderboard](/leaderboard)[Changelog](/changelog)[Analyze](/analyze)[Collections](/collections)[Log in](/login)[Sign up](/register)

1. [Directory](/)
2. /
3. techrino/vue-tailwind-laravel-ui-preset

ActiveLibrary

techrino/vue-tailwind-laravel-ui-preset
=======================================

A Vue Tailwind Laravel UI Preset inspired by VueCLI

1.0.0(5y ago)07MITJavaScript

Since Oct 3Pushed 5y ago1 watchersCompare

[ Source](https://github.com/leeliwei930/vue-tailwind-laravel-ui-preset)[ Packagist](https://packagist.org/packages/techrino/vue-tailwind-laravel-ui-preset)[ RSS](/packages/techrino-vue-tailwind-laravel-ui-preset/feed)WikiDiscussions master Synced 3d ago

READMEChangelog (1)Dependencies (1)Versions (2)Used By (0)

Vue Tailwind Laravel UI Preset
==============================

[](#vue-tailwind-laravel-ui-preset)

What's inside this presets?

- Vue 2.6.12
- Laravel Mix 5
- Tailwind 1.8.x
- Pug Template Engine for writing Vue SFC template
- ESLint (Optional)
    - ESLint Import Resolver Alias
    - ESLint Airbnb config

### Available Presets

[](#available-presets)

#### `vue-tailwind-preset`

[](#vue-tailwind-preset)

This preset exclude any eslint configuration

#### `vue-tailwind-eslint-preset`

[](#vue-tailwind-eslint-preset)

This preset contains eslint configuration with Vue recommended code style rule enforced.

#### `vue-tailwind-airbnb-eslint-preset`

[](#vue-tailwind-airbnb-eslint-preset)

This preset contains eslint configuration with Vue + Airbnb JavaScript code style rule enforced.

### 1.0 Installation

[](#10-installation)

```
$ composer require techrino/vue-tailwind-laravel-ui-preset
```

### 1.1 Initialize Preset

[](#11-initialize-preset)

> ⚠️ Warning
>
> Please the command below will overwrite some configuration that are listed in

[List of created configuration](#1.1.1-List-of-created-configuration)

```
$ ▶ artisan ui vue-tailwind

   Select a frontend stack:
    [vue-tailwind-preset              ] Vue + Tailwind CSS
    [vue-tailwind-eslint-preset       ] Vue + Tailwind CSS + ESLint
    [vue-tailwind-airbnb-eslint-preset] Vue + Tailwind CSS + airbnb ESLint
   >
   # Using directional key select a choice
```

#### 1.1.1 List of created configuration

[](#111-list-of-created-configuration)

Once the command above is executed, these configurations file will be placed to your projects.

```
./tailwind.config.js
./postcss.config.js
./webpack.config.js
./webpack.mix.js
./.eslintrc.json
./.eslintignore
./resources/views
./cypress
